Beniamino Gigli was one of the finest Tenors of all time. That being said, this set offers some of the best work the great Tenor ever recorded. Real standout renditions here are all of the duets recorded with Baritone and friend Giuseppe De Luca, the two lovely arias from Mignon, O Paradiso (rivaled only by Bjoerling and Lanza), Lucia selections (pretty much the entire final scene of the last act), and the Neapolitan selections (such as Toselli's hauntingly beautiful "Rimpianto"). The duets with Ruffo are interesting, but without the subtlety and finesse the same selections with De Luca possess. All three of the Romophon sets of Gigli's Victor recordings are prizes indeed (the third volume being only 1 CD), but this is, in this reviewer's humble opinion, the best of the three.
